Visual Recovery Reflects Cortical MeCP2 Sensitivity in Rett Syndrome

open access: yesAnnals of Clinical and Translational Neurology, EarlyView.
ABSTRACT Objective Rett syndrome (RTT) is a devastating neurodevelopmental disorder with developmental regression affecting motor, sensory, and cognitive functions. Sensory disruptions contribute to the complex behavioral and cognitive difficulties and represent an important target for therapeutic interventions.

The Impact of Tilburg Frailty on Poststroke Fatigue in First‐Ever Stroke Patients: A Cross‐Sectional Study With Unified Measurement Tools and Improved Statistics

open access: yesAnnals of Clinical and Translational Neurology, EarlyView.
ABSTRACT Background Poststroke fatigue (PSF) and frailty share substantial overlap in their manifestations, yet previous research has yielded conflicting results due to the use of heterogeneous frailty assessment tools.
